HTML5速查手册:核心技术与标签解析

需积分: 50 0 下载量 164 浏览量 更新于2024-09-11 收藏 130KB PDF 举报
"HTML5快速索引指南" HTML5是现代网页开发的标准,它引入了许多新的元素、属性和功能,以提升用户体验和开发效率。这份HTML5快速索引指南提供了对HTML5标签、属性及其适用版本的简洁概述。以下是对部分核心内容的详细解释: 1. **<!---->**: 这是注释标签,用于在代码中插入不显示给用户的说明。在HTML5的4/5版本中都是有效的。 2. **<!DOCTYPE>:** 定义文档类型声明,告诉浏览器使用哪种HTML或XML规范来解析页面。在HTML5中,通常写作`<!DOCTYPE html>`,适用于所有HTML5版本。 3. **<a>:** 链接标签,创建超链接,允许用户跳转到其他页面或资源。支持的属性包括`href`(链接地址)、`hreflang`(链接语言)、`media`(目标媒体类型)、`ping`(跟踪链接点击)、`rel`(链接关系)、`target`(打开链接的新窗口或标签页)和`type`(资源类型)。 4. **<abbr>:** 缩写标签,用于表示缩写词,可以添加`title`属性提供完整单词或短语的解释。 5. **<acronym>:** 在HTML5中已废弃,用于表示首字母缩略词,但在HTML4中使用。 6. **<address>:** 地址标签,用于表示作者或文档维护者的联系信息,可添加全局属性。 7. **<article>:** 文章标签,用于组织独立的内容,可以自包含并独立于上下文理解。 8. **<aside>:** 侧边内容标签,用于包含与主内容相关的补充信息,例如侧栏或注释。 9. **<audio>:** 音频标签,用于嵌入音频内容。支持的属性有`autobuffer`(预加载音频)、`autoplay`(自动播放)、`controls`(显示播放控制)、`loop`(循环播放)和`src`(音频源)。 10. **<b>:** 加粗文本标签,用于强调文本,但更推荐使用`<strong>`标签来表示强调。 11. **<base>:** 基础标签,设置文档的所有链接的基础URL,属性`href`定义基础URL,`target`指定链接在何处打开。 12. **<basefont>:** 在HTML5中已废弃,用于设置文档的默认字体大小和颜色。 13. **<bdo>:** 文本方向标签,用于指定文字的显示方向,如从右到左(`dir="rtl"`)或从左到右(`dir="ltr"`)。 14. **<big>:** 大号文本标签,在HTML5中已废弃,用于显示稍大的文本。 15. **<blockquote>:** 引用标签,用于插入长段落引用,可以添加`cite`属性提供引用来源。 16. **<body>:** 身体标签,定义HTML文档的主要内容,可以添加全局属性。 17. **<br>:** 换行标签,用于插入一个简单的换行,通常用于文本布局。 这只是HTML5索引的一部分,还有许多其他标签和属性,包括表单元素、结构元素、多媒体支持、离线存储、拖放功能、画布和SVG等,都在HTML5的范畴内。这份指南提供了快速查找和了解这些元素的便利,是开发人员日常工作的得力助手。